Overview
- The blast struck the ground floor of a four-storey residential building in the small town northwest of Lyon on Monday evening.
- At least four people were injured, according to local reporting relaying the prefecture's information.
- Windows at a nearby school were shattered by the force of the explosion, local media reported.
- Authorities confirmed the incident and urged the public to avoid the area during the emergency response.
- A mother and an older sibling of the two young victims escaped the building, according to one report.
